Title: **Micha Galor Gluskin: Innovator in Image Processing Technology**
Introduction
Micha Galor Gluskin, based in San Diego, California, is a prominent inventor with a remarkable portfolio of 27 patents. His innovative work primarily focuses on advancements in image processing technology, particularly for cameras. As a key figure at Qualcomm Incorporated, Micha continues to push the boundaries of how we capture and process images.
Latest Patents
Among Gluskin's recent patents is a groundbreaking invention titled "Low-power fusion for negative shutter lag capture." This patent outlines systems and techniques for processing multiple frames from an image capture system. The process is designed to minimize lag during capture by obtaining frames across different settings domains. Another notable patent, "Image processing for aperture size transition in a variable aperture (VA) camera," discusses methods and devices that enhance image signal processing during aperture transitions, ensuring optimal performance in variable aperture camera operations.
